How To Calculate Max In Excel

Excel MAX Function Calculator

Calculate the maximum value in your Excel dataset with this interactive tool

Maximum Value:
Position in Dataset:
Excel Formula:

Comprehensive Guide: How to Calculate MAX in Excel

Microsoft Excel’s MAX function is one of the most fundamental yet powerful tools for data analysis. Whether you’re working with financial data, scientific measurements, or business metrics, finding the maximum value in a dataset is often the first step in understanding your data’s range and identifying outliers.

Basic MAX Function Syntax

The basic syntax for the MAX function is:

=MAX(number1, [number2], ...)

Where:

  • number1 – Required. The first number or range
  • [number2], … – Optional. Up to 255 additional numbers or ranges

Key Features

  • Works with both numbers and cell references
  • Ignores empty cells and text values
  • Can handle up to 255 arguments
  • Available in all Excel versions since 2003

Step-by-Step Guide to Using MAX in Excel

  1. Select the cell where you want the result to appear

    Click on any empty cell in your worksheet where you want the maximum value to be displayed.

  2. Type the MAX function

    Begin typing =MAX( and Excel will show the function tooltip.

  3. Select your data range

    You can either:

    • Manually type the cell references (e.g., A1:A10)
    • Click and drag to select the range with your mouse
    • Type individual numbers separated by commas (e.g., =MAX(15, 23, 7, 42))
  4. Close the function

    Type the closing parenthesis ) and press Enter.

Advanced MAX Function Techniques

The MAX function becomes even more powerful when combined with other Excel features:

MAX with Conditions

To find the maximum value that meets specific criteria, combine MAX with IF:

=MAX(IF(range=criteria, values))

Note: This is an array formula – press Ctrl+Shift+Enter in older Excel versions.

MAX with Dates

Excel stores dates as serial numbers, so MAX works perfectly with dates:

=MAX(A1:A10) where A1:A10 contains dates

Format the result cell as a date to display properly.

MAX with Wildcards

For text-based maximums, use MAX with other functions:

=MAX(LEN(range)) finds the longest text string

Common Errors and Solutions

Error Cause Solution
#VALUE! Non-numeric values in range Use =MAX(IF(ISNUMBER(range), range)) as array formula
#NAME? Misspelled function name Check for typos in “MAX”
#DIV/0! Empty range reference Ensure your range contains numbers
#NUM! Invalid numeric values Check for cells with error values

MAX vs. Other Excel Functions

Function Purpose When to Use Instead of MAX Example
LARGE Finds nth largest value When you need 2nd, 3rd, etc. highest values =LARGE(A1:A10, 2)
MAXA Includes TRUE/FALSE in calculation When working with logical values =MAXA(A1:A10)
DMAX Maximum in database meeting criteria For structured data tables =DMAX(database, field, criteria)
AGGREGATE Flexible aggregation with options When you need to ignore hidden rows =AGGREGATE(4, 5, A1:A10)

Real-World Applications of MAX Function

  1. Financial Analysis

    Identify peak values in stock prices, revenue streams, or expense reports to understand best performance periods.

  2. Inventory Management

    Track maximum inventory levels to optimize storage space and reorder points.

  3. Quality Control

    Find maximum defect rates or measurement variations to identify quality issues.

  4. Sports Statistics

    Calculate highest scores, fastest times, or other peak performances in athletic data.

  5. Scientific Research

    Determine maximum values in experimental data to identify significant results.

Performance Considerations

When working with large datasets, consider these performance tips:

  • Use defined names instead of cell references for better readability and potentially better performance with very large ranges.
  • Avoid volatile functions like INDIRECT with MAX, as they can slow down calculations.
  • For extremely large datasets (100,000+ rows), consider using Power Query or PivotTables instead of MAX functions.
  • Use manual calculation mode (Formulas > Calculation Options) when working with many MAX functions to improve responsiveness.

Learning Resources

For more advanced Excel techniques, consider these authoritative resources:

Excel MAX Function in Different Versions

Excel Version MAX Function Support Notable Changes
Excel 2003 Basic support Limited to 30 arguments
Excel 2007 Full support Expanded to 255 arguments
Excel 2013 Full support Improved array handling
Excel 2016 Full support Better performance with large datasets
Excel 2019 Full support Dynamic array support introduced
Excel 365 Full support + new functions MAXIFS function added for conditional maximums

Alternative Methods to Find Maximum Values

While the MAX function is the most direct method, Excel offers several alternative approaches:

  1. Sorting

    Sort your data in descending order to bring the maximum value to the top of your dataset.

  2. Conditional Formatting

    Use the “Top 10 Items” rule to highlight the maximum value(s) in your range.

  3. PivotTables

    Create a PivotTable and use the “Max” summary function for your values.

  4. Power Query

    In the Power Query Editor, use the “Statistics” > “Maximum” operation.

  5. VBA Macros

    Write a custom VBA function for more complex maximum calculations.

Common Business Scenarios Using MAX

Sales Analysis

Find the highest sales figure across products, regions, or time periods to identify top performers.

=MAX(sales_range)

Project Management

Determine the longest task duration in a project timeline to identify critical path components.

=MAX(task_durations)

Financial Reporting

Calculate peak expenses or revenues for budgeting and forecasting purposes.

=MAX(monthly_expenses)

Troubleshooting MAX Function Issues

When your MAX function isn’t working as expected, try these troubleshooting steps:

  1. Check for text values

    Ensure all cells in your range contain numbers. Text values (even numbers stored as text) will be ignored.

  2. Verify cell formatting

    Cells formatted as text or with custom formats might not be recognized as numbers.

  3. Look for hidden characters

    Spaces or non-printing characters can prevent Excel from recognizing numbers.

  4. Check for circular references

    If your MAX function refers to itself (directly or indirectly), it will cause errors.

  5. Use the Evaluate Formula tool

    Found under Formulas > Evaluate Formula, this helps step through complex MAX calculations.

The Future of MAX in Excel

Microsoft continues to enhance Excel’s statistical functions. Recent and upcoming developments include:

  • Dynamic Arrays: The ability to return multiple values from a single MAX-related function call.
  • AI-Powered Insights: Excel’s Ideas feature can automatically detect and highlight maximum values in your data.
  • Enhanced Data Types: New data types like Stocks and Geography may include specialized MAX-related functions.
  • Cloud Collaboration: Real-time MAX calculations in co-authoring scenarios with Excel Online.

Conclusion

The MAX function is a cornerstone of Excel’s analytical capabilities. From simple datasets to complex financial models, the ability to quickly identify maximum values provides critical insights for decision-making. By mastering MAX and its related functions, you’ll significantly enhance your data analysis skills in Excel.

Remember that the key to effective MAX function use lies in:

  • Understanding your data structure
  • Choosing the right variation (MAX, MAXA, MAXIFS, etc.)
  • Combining with other functions for advanced analysis
  • Applying proper formatting to ensure accurate results

As you become more comfortable with MAX, explore how it integrates with Excel’s broader ecosystem of functions and features to create powerful, dynamic analyses that drive business insights.

Leave a Reply

Your email address will not be published. Required fields are marked *